I was eating lunch the first time I ever watched Tim and Eric Awesome Show Great Job!, and I found the show so disgusting, I had to put down my sandwich. But I also found it just intriguing enough to watch another episode—which also disgusted me, but intrigued me just enough to watch one more. Soon, I was hooked.

Tim and Eric are a phenomenon unto themselves. You can’t really compare them to anyone, except maybe Andy Kaufman and the way he always had his audience guessing where the joke was—or if there was a joke at all.

There’s just something about them, something about the horrifying makeup, the actors who look like they were picked up from an abandoned bus stop, the outlandish names (Jimes Tooper; Bush Printzel; James Sprunt; Spraynard Kruger), the outrageous concepts (a cop show called C.O.R.B.S. [Cops on Recumbent Bikes], a cell phone that severely burns your face and only has one button [but comes with face soothing cream], a band called Pusswhip Banggang). Love them or hate them, these ain’t your average huckleberry hounds.

The last thing I said before ending our interview was, “It’s amazing that two people with your sense of humor found each other.” Without missing a beat, Tim replied: “I guess that’s one of the many reasons we believe in Christ, and the path that he provides us with is obviously all about faith.”
